 The development of Giesemann Word Clock x 10M Master Clock for dCS system

AfterDark. developed a new Master Clock for dCS user who want to try to maximise the performance for the dCS system with Word Clock on 44.1kHz or 48kHz. The Giesemann will included extra 10M Master Clock out for connecting audiophile switch such as UpTone EtherREGEN accepting 10M Master Clock signal bypassing the internal clock.

The Giesemann Word Clock x 10M Master clock will have following features:

  1. Three independently outputs on 75ohm BNC connectors. Each group may be preset to a different clock frequency. 
  2. For dCS system: Output 1: 44.1KHz / Output 2: 48kHz / Output 3: 10M Master Clock
  3. AfterDark. Project ClayX Linear Power Supply build in to optimised the performance for Giesemann Clock, the power inlet is from Furutech NCF. 
  4. Customer can made to order and choose the grading on Giesemann OCXO Clock from Queen to Giesemann EVA
  5. Carbon Fiber shielding and machines aluminium chassis fitted with AfterDark Audiophile WoodMAT to reduces vibration.

Giesemann OCXO Features 
The product uses the selected audio grade OCXO, and through long-term calibration to select and install equipment with excellent stability.

  • OCXO that employs with qualitative measure equipment.
  • OCXO is enclosed and covered with Dynamat Extreme Corporation (Made in USA) which is used to stabilize and minimize heat separation,  addition EMI material from KEMET EMI Shielding is placed on top of OCXO,  the outer layer is covered with real leather to isolate the heat factors for maximizing OCXO performance . 
  • Alu material + Carbon Fiber material front and backplate, solid anti-vibration. In addition, due to the thickness used, 3mm / 6mm Carbon Fiber material material with plate can provide solid EMI/ magnetic coverage.
  • Advanced instrument Symmetricom 5125A calibrated with plotted characteristics. The phase noise, and Allen Derivation defines different grades of the OCXO. 
  • Audio Note Silver Solder
  • Duelund AC0.4 Silver Premium Audio Cable (Silver in Cotton / Oil impregnated) (Handmade in Denmark)
  • Ultra High Quality Large Factor 5151 SC Cut OCXO, very low phase noise and frequency stability compared to others small size OCXO specification 
  • SC Cut refers to stress compensated (SC) cut crystal resonators, which is more advance on performance of Frequency Vs Temperature changes, longer Crystal Aging. The pro is expensive to made and size is larger then normal OCXO. 
  • Then Large Factor size 5151 is around 5cm x 5cm dimension vs small factor 3cm x 2cm, 2 times bigger with better phase noise performances. 
  • OCXO are available in tailor made on various audio frequencies on special request.

Level selection value
The OCXO installed in the product can calibrate the products used in industrial equipment for a long time, and use equipment with good characteristics. In order to optimally select the audio clock, we comprehensively evaluate with Symmetricom Flagship 5125A to analysis the phase noise characteristics and short-term stability (Allen dispersion) that can be determinate the OCXO grading accordingly.

The OCXO installed in this product uses a stable OCXO unit that has been calibrated for several months. In order to make the best choice of OCXO. We are conducting a comprehensive evaluation of phase noise characteristics and short-term stability (Allen dispersion) during detailed inspection. 

The final product will final measured and fine tuned with Keysight 53220A with reference to Atomic Clock , GPSDO.

Quality of OCXO is determined by Phase Noise at 1Hz / at 10Hz
Phase noise: -119 to -113 dBc / Hz or lower at 1 Hz offset (Grades) -137 dBc / Hz or lower at 10 Hz offset

 

GRADE Phase Noise@ 10Hz Phase Noise@ 1Hz
PRINCE -131 -100
QUEEN -132 -103
KING -134 -107
Emperor Signature  -138 -110
Emperor CROWN -140 -113
Emperor DOUBLE CROWN -141 -117
Emperor TRIPLE CROWN -142 -118
Emperor Giesemann -143 -120
Emperor Giesemann EVA -145 -121

 

Allan variance short-term stability reference value

[Emperor Giesemann EVA]TAU = 1sec 2.50E-13 or less(0.00025ppb / s)

[Emperor Giesemann] TAU = 1sec 2.78E-13 or less(0.00028ppb / s)
[Emperor Triple Crown] TAU = 1sec 3.8E-13 or less(0.00038ppb / s)
